The AI Search Wars: Bing, Google, and OpenAI
The battle to lead in AI-powered search has intensified, with Microsoft’s Bing making bold strides against Google’s entrenched dominance. Bing’s new “generative search” feature marks a significant evolution, blending conventional search results with AI-generated summaries. This hybrid model promises a transformative shift in how users discover and interact with information online.
Google has steadfastly maintained its position with AI-enhanced search capabilities, continuously refining algorithms to ensure more accurate and relevant results. However, OpenAI has entered the fray with its “SearchGPT” prototype, augmenting the capabilities of ChatGPT for more efficient information retrieval. The ongoing competition among these tech giants could redefine the landscape of eCommerce and digital marketing, making AI-powered search a pivotal factor in online interactions.
AI Delivery Bots: Reshaping eCommerce Logistics
The world of eCommerce logistics is on the brink of transformation, thanks to innovative AI delivery bots. Vayu Robotics has introduced a groundbreaking autonomous delivery bot that combines advanced AI with cost-effective sensors, bypassing expensive lidar technology. This innovation promises to drastically cut delivery expenses, making it accessible even for smaller carriers and direct-to-consumer brands.
As eCommerce continues its rapid growth, such AI-powered solutions are set to play a crucial role in optimizing supply chains and enhancing customer experiences. These smart delivery bots can navigate complex urban environments, ensuring timely and efficient deliveries without human intervention, thereby driving down operational costs and improving service quality.
World Labs: A Rising AI Unicorn
World Labs, the brainchild of renowned AI pioneer Fei-Fei Li, has achieved unicorn status within an astonishingly short period. Valued at $1 billion just four months after its inception, the startup is focused on enabling computers to comprehend the three-dimensional world—a leap forward in machine perception.
Funded by tech heavyweights like Andreessen Horowitz, World Labs is poised to push the boundaries of computer vision and cognitively inspired AI. While specific details of their projects remain confidential, the rapid ascent of World Labs underscores the vast potential for technological advancements in AI, promising breakthroughs that could revolutionize numerous industries.
AI and Edge Computing: Disrupting Commerce
The fusion of AI and edge computing is accelerating, bringing faster localized data processing to various industries. This convergence is particularly impactful for retail, supply chains, and customer service, where real-time data handling can significantly improve operational efficiency and user experiences.
Companies like Code Metal, with substantial investments amounting to $16.45 million, are pioneering AI-driven workflows to expedite product development and enhance process efficiencies. In retail, the integration of AI and edge computing can lead to immediate inventory updates and personalized shopping experiences. In manufacturing, it can optimize production lines and enable predictive maintenance, thereby reducing downtime and costs.
Impact on Tech Giants: Growth, Costs, and Challenges
The ongoing AI revolution is reshaping the operational landscapes of tech giants. Google Cloud, for instance, has crossed the $10 billion quarterly revenue milestone, driven largely by burgeoning AI demand. Concurrently, the cost of innovation is steep, with research and development expenditure soaring to $11.9 billion.
ServiceNow’s AI tool, Now Assist, has propelled record-breaking deals, though the company faces internal restructuring challenges. In the healthcare sector, dental AI startup Pearl has secured $58 million in funding to revolutionize X-ray analysis and streamline insurance claims processing. These developments highlight the dual nature of AI advancements—ushering in rapid growth and innovation while simultaneously escalating financial and operational pressures.
Regulatory Response: A Unified Front
In a significant move, regulatory bodies from the United States, European Union, and United Kingdom have joined forces to address potential antitrust issues within AI. Their joint statement emphasizes concerns about market concentration and anti-competitive behaviors in the generative AI sector. This unified approach aims to ensure fair competition and mitigate risks associated with the monopolization of critical AI resources by tech giants.
Meta has voiced concerns over stringent EU AI regulations, warning of a potential technological disparity between Europe and other regions. Nonetheless, coordinated oversight is essential for fostering a balanced and competitive AI landscape while safeguarding consumer interests and promoting innovation.
